* fix(tooling): scope dead-export detection to source files
Matching only the top-level tree let a docs file under src/ carrying `export`
in a code sample set the flag. That mattered because the flag also short-
circuited changedCheckRequiresRemote above its docsOnly guard, so a docs-only
change could be dragged onto the heavy remote route and made to run knip.
Scope detection to the source extensions knip actually reads, and drop the
routing branch entirely: any file that can now trigger detection already
enables a non-docs lane, which the existing final clause routes remotely. The
branch was dead for every real source change and wrong for the docs case.

* fix(tooling): select the dead-export scan by path, not changed lines
Inspecting changed lines for an `export` token has two false negatives that
defeat the purpose. Barrels export through multiline `export { ... }` lists, so
removing a symbol changes a line carrying no `export` token. Worse, the failure
that motivated this scan was an import-only edit: it orphaned a re-export in a
barrel the diff never touched, which no changed-line rule can see.
Select by path instead: any changed production source file under src/,
extensions/, ui/, or packages/. This also removes the merge-base dependency, so
a shallow checkout or unrelated history can no longer silently skip the scan.
Those paths already enable a non-docs lane, so the run already routes remotely
and knip's cost lands on the box already doing the heavy work.
OPENCLAW_CHECK_CHANGED_SKIP_DEADCODE=1 still opts out.
* Revert "feat(tooling): repin PR review artifacts"
The repin subcommand defeats the property the identity pin exists to enforce.
It rewrites the pinned PR number and head SHA while keeping every
recommendation, finding, and Markdown conclusion, so a completed
"READY FOR /prepare-pr" verdict authored against one revision can be relabelled
as covering another and then pass validation. The test added alongside it
restamped PR #7 as PR #42 and asserted validation succeeded, which is exactly
the substitution the fail-closed gate was built to stop.
Re-authoring a review after the head moves is friction on purpose: the code the
verdict describes may no longer be the code being landed. A safe version has to
prove the reviewed content is equivalent across the move, which is a design
decision about what equivalence means, not a convenience wrapper.
Reverts 5d89a704d9 and its follow-up c6304eb539.

* fix(scripts): run changed checks locally when Blacksmith never ran them
AGENTS.md already says trusted-source work falls back to local execution when
the remote backend is unavailable, but the tooling did not implement it: a lease,
broker, DNS, or network failure surfaced as a plain exit 1, so the lanes were
reported red without ever having been evaluated. That is worse than slow — a run
that never happened looked the same as a run that failed.
Tee the wrapper output and use its run summary as the discriminator. The summary
only appears once the command reached the box, so a failure carrying
`command-exit` is a real verdict and propagates unchanged; anything else never
produced one and re-runs locally, with a loud note so the proof summary records
which machine produced it.
Deliberately a positive test for `command-exit` rather than a blocklist of
infrastructure errors. Guessing wrong toward "infrastructure" only re-runs the
checks locally; guessing wrong toward "real failure" would block on an outage.
It must never widen to "fall back on any non-zero exit" — prompt snapshots are
Linux-only truth and would pass locally on macOS, turning a red gate green.
The sparse-checkout path keeps no fallback: it exists precisely because the
checkout cannot resolve the diff refs, so there is nothing local to run.
* fix(scripts): require positive pre-dispatch evidence before falling back
A missing run summary does not prove the remote never started: a wrapper that
crashes or loses its output transport after dispatch looks identical. Reading
that absence as "never ran" would rerun locally and could turn an unknown or
failing Linux-only lane green, which is the exact masking this guard exists to
prevent.
Require a positive pre-dispatch signature instead, and keep the command-exit
veto. Also reapply backpressure on the tee: inherited stdio got it from the OS,
piping does not, so a verbose delegated run could buffer its whole output here.
* build(deps): remove npm shrinkwrap; mirror pnpm lock into transient package locks
npm 12 removed shrinkwrap (command + tarball/root loading). Delete all 82
committed npm-shrinkwrap.json files and stop publishing lockfiles; keep
pnpm-lock.yaml as the single reviewed dependency boundary. The generator
becomes scripts/generate-npm-package-lock.mjs and feeds plugin bundling via
a transient package-lock.json + npm ci (works on npm 11 and 12). Tarball
validation treats the published 2026.7.2 beta train as a shrinkwrap
transition; self-update npm detection now uses install topology instead of
the shipped shrinkwrap.

* feat(sessions): keep archived transcripts by default with zstd cold storage
Codex-style retention: deleting or resetting a session archives its
transcript as a zstd-compressed JSONL artifact (plain when the runtime
lacks node:zlib zstd) and keeps it until the disk budget evicts oldest
first. resetArchiveRetention now governs both deleted and reset archives
and defaults to keep; maxDiskBytes defaults to 2gb so retention stays
bounded, with archives evicted before live sessions. The cron reaper
follows the same knob instead of deleting archives on its own timer.
* fix(state): converge agent DB migration lineages and bound database growth
Merge coherence: run both structure-gated legacy memory-schema repairs
(flip-lineage drop, main-lineage identity rebuild) before the flip
migration so pre-flip v1/v2 and pre-merge flip v1/v4 databases all
converge, and hoist foreign_keys=OFF outside the schema transaction
where the pragma was silently ignored and the v1 sessions rebuild
cascade-deleted session_entries.
Growth guards: fresh agent DBs enable auto_vacuum=INCREMENTAL, WAL
maintenance releases freed pages in bounded passes (never a blocking
full VACUUM), and doctor reports state/agent DB bloat from freelist
stats.
